Stencyl is a user-friendly game development platform designed to enable users of varying skill levels to create 2D games without extensive programming knowledge. It features a drag-and-drop interface, a visual scripting system, and a flexible environment suitable for both beginners and more experienced developers aiming to publish on multiple platforms.
Key Features
- Intuitive drag-and-drop interface for easy game creation
- Visual scripting system called 'Behavior Blocks' for custom logic
- Extensive library of pre-made assets and templates
- Multi-platform publishing support including iOS, Android, HTML5, and desktop
- Integrated testing tools and debugging options
- Community marketplace for assets and plugins
Pros
- Accessible for beginners with no prior coding experience
- Rapid prototyping capabilities
- Supports deployment across multiple platforms
- Active community and resource sharing
- Cost-effective with free tiers available
Cons
- Limited customization options compared to code-based engines
- Performance may be insufficient for complex or resource-intensive games
- Learning curve can still be present when integrating custom behaviors
- Less suitable for high-end or AAA-style game development
- Some features require paid upgrades
